There are many others, but all operate according to the same basic principle: compare your list of games against "DAT" files provided by trusted sources to determine whether your games match the known-good backups. Clrmamepro and Romcenter are two popular options. There are a number of tools and resources to assist with this.

By validating your copy matches that of a known good copy, you can be assured that it is safe to play and as authentic and widely compatible as possible. Because of this, it's important to verify your game backups against trusted sources. As a result, there's a great variety in the quality of these game backups online, ranging from nearly perfect ("1:1") copies to corrupt, improperly formatted, or even maliciously infected game backups.
